Everything about the name KHAMON
Meaning, origin, history
Khamon is a unique and captivating name of Egyptian origin. It is derived from the ancient Egyptian word "khem" which means "black earth". In ancient Egypt, the Nile River would flood each year, leaving behind rich black soil that was perfect for farming. This soil was referred to as "khem" and was considered sacred because it sustained life.
